Opinion: Let’s ensure Kentucky mothers like me have a second chance
Written by Kim George, a community organizer for Advocacy Based on Lived Experience. George is a Paducah resident, former registered nurse, mom, person in long term recovery, and was formerly incarcerated. She has been afforded opportunities to rebuild her life and had her voting rights restored per Governor Beshear’s 2019 executive order. Today, she is an advocate for others, who — like her — deserve a chance to get it right.

Wake Up Weather 5.8.24
PADUCAH — The severe weather outlook for a large portion of the Local 6 region has been upgraded to a moderate risk for today. Storms are expected to run from late this morning around 11 a.m. to perhaps past midnight. There is a threat for possibly some tornadoes, damaging winds, hail, and flooding.
